Transaction eadf7367b79d387ba91b24e934f913b85f3fa32edc330f7df799a432d4118343

block
409095395cde550baee4fd6ec6f5ba28abdc354724cdc10b5c258c0e4bbeaa3e

1 Input

21 Outputs